The 4-Series of AudioQuest speakers cables may be the most successful in AudioQuests 30+ year history. Type 4's roots go all the way back to the late 80's. The fundamental geometry and conductor complement of Type 4 hasn't changed since 1995 ... because any change to the size or position of the 4-Series' 2-sized Spread-Spectrum conductor arrangement would reduce performance.SOLID LONG-GRAIN COPPER CONDUCTORS (LGC): Type 4s solid Long-Grain Copper allows a smoother and clearer sound than cables using typical OFHC (Oxygen-Free High-Conductivity) copper. OFHC is a general metal industry specification regarding loss without any concern for distortion. LGC has fewer oxides within the conducting material, less impurities, less grain boundaries, and definitively better performance. All four of Type 4s conductors are solid. Electrical and magnetic interaction between strands in a conventional cable is the single greatest source of distortion, often causing a somewhat harsh, dirty and confused sound. Solid conductors are the most important ingredients enabling Type 4s very clear sound. Whether a conductor is solid or stranded, skin-effect is a prime distortion mechanism in speaker cables.
